Designing the Transportation of the Future: The SkyWay Transport Systems, Part 2 of 2

On today’s program, we’ll meet Mr. Artjoms Kurbanovs, the SkyWay Group of Companies investor from Latvia. He tells us about the Unifly, a vehicle designed to replace the family car. “We're now at our high-speed ‘Unifly,’ the transport that moves at 500 km/h. And to drive it, to operate it, will cost much less, because to build all this we need less resources, less time plus it’s total eco-friendliness: no pollution of either air or Earth.” In addition to its unique aerodynamic design, the Unifly has many other advantages over our traditional means of transportation. “It’s amazing: the weight is very low. So, we have great energy-saving for driving. This vehicle moves on solar batteries, on wind energy - this is transport that uses renewable kinds of energy.” One of the greatest benefits is that the entire system is elevated, which substantially improves its operational safety. One of the most exciting features of SkyWay’s system is that it will leave a minimal footprint on Earth. SkyWay believes that their unique system will make it much easier and faster for people to travel to work.
